Output 8cfc138cc130409f3107f4b19a68314bf20c2594de222d62186b39ceb026f51f:2

value
11495
script pubkey
OP_0 OP_PUSHBYTES_20 53392e1b38b9ae8778af435dd106fa06c03d1750
address
bc1q2vujuxechxhgw790gdwazph6qmqr696s5h629f
transaction
8cfc138cc130409f3107f4b19a68314bf20c2594de222d62186b39ceb026f51f
confirmations
11006
spent
true